Daytona Beach, FL – A 32-year-old man recently discharged from a hospital is hit and killed by a vehicle on New Year’s Day.
The Daytona Beach Police Department says it happened around 7:20 PM on North Williamson Boulevard near the LPGA Boulevard intersection.
Witnesses claim Joseph J. Hartley Jr. was walking in the middle of the northbound lanes towards oncoming traffic, according to DBPD Sergeant James Chirco.
“A passerby stopped and attempted to see if the victim was in need of assistance,” Chirco stated. “The victim darted west across the roadway and was struck by a white Toyota Rav 4 [going] south on Williamson.”
The impact knocked Hartley into a ditch on the west side of the roadway, according to the incident report.
Paramedics took Hartley to Florida Hospital Memorial Medical Center. That’s where he died around 30 minutes later.
Hartley had been recently released from that same hospital for an unknown medical condition, per Chirco.
Charges are pending at this time as the investigation continues.
